The Los Angeles Clippers are very proud of their brand new home, LA’s Intuit Dome.
There are many amazing features in the arena, including a section that the team is referring to as “The Wall.”
Only veteran and proven Clippers fans will be sitting in this section of the stadium and the team hopes they will be supportive, consistent, and loud night after night.
Speaking with All the Smoke Productions, diehard Lakers fan Snoop Dogg had a thought about this unique part of the arena.
“Well, it’s gonna be kinda empty in that m———-r,” Snoop said with a smile.

The Clippers have gone all-out with their new arena.
It’s not only “The Wall” that is special in the Intuit Dome.
The recently unveiled stadium also has charging stations at every seat, a one-of-a-kind, immersive screen, and more.
It’s a truly revolutionary piece of architecture and engineering but that doesn’t mean all NBA fans are excited about it.
Even with their brand new home, the Clippers are still battling to be the most loved team in Los Angeles and they are trying to break through the rest of the Western Conference.
Their chances of having a great season diminished in the summer when they lost multiple players, including Paul George and Russell Westbrook.
Fans are worried that this season will look a lot like the ones that have come before it: full of great promise and talent but also plagued by injuries and dashed hopes.
Snoop and certain NBA fans are impressed by the new arena and its novel ideas but that doesn’t mean they are suddenly going to love the Clippers.
